Israeli gov’t okays plan to build hundreds of settler units in O. Jerusalem

OCCUPIED JERUSALEM, (The Palestine Foundation Pakistan)

The Israeli occupation government has approved the construction of 1,300 new settler units in the illegal settlement bloc of Gush Etzion in the southeast of Occupied Jerusalem.

According to Israel’s Channel 14, the government’s planning and building committee approved the plan earlier this week.

According to Israel’s Channel 14, the units will be built in the neighborhood of “Russian Compound” to the south of Alon Shvut settlement.

The settlement expansion plan include schools, public buildings, parks, and a large commercial zone expected to serve surrounding settlements, making it the largest settlement expansion plan in the area in recent years.

The decision comes less than a week after US President Donald Trump criticized Israeli settlement activity in the occupied West Bank.

“Don’t worry about the West Bank. Israel’s not going to do anything with the West Bank,” Trump told reporters at the White House on October 24.

His remarks came a day after the Israeli Knesset gave preliminary approval to two draft laws to annex the occupied West Bank and the Ma’ale Adumim settlement bloc, a move that would isolate east Jerusalem from its Palestinian surrounding and divide the West Bank into two.
